Start by assembling a foundation of versatile pieces that can be easily mixed. A well-tailored blazer, crisp button-down shirts, and classic trousers are essential components of any business casual wardrobe. Accessorize your outfits with a statement necklace, a pair of stylish earrings, or a chic scarf to add a touch of personality.

Remember that comfort is key. Choose fabrics that feel good against your skin and allow you to flow freely. Avoid anything too tight, too loose, or very revealing. When in doubt, err on the side of simplicity.

Deciphering Business Casual vs. Business Professional: What's the Difference?

In the realm of workplace attire, two prevalent dress codes often cause quandary: business casual and business professional. While both aim for a polished appearance, subtle nuances differentiate them. Business professional, the more strict option, typically demands suits, ties, blouses, and dresses. This code projects an air of authority and sophistication. On the other hand, business read more casual offers a comfortable alternative, allowing for chinos, khakis, button-down shirts, and skirts.

While it may seem simple, deciphering the appropriate dress code can be difficult. Consider the work environment you're in. For instance, a consulting firm might lean towards a more formal business professional look, while a creative environment may embrace a more relaxed business casual approach. Ultimately, when in doubt, err on the side of professionalism.
